This post was made with another stylesheet and it might be messed up!
Files 3.8 will now have an option to add a TreeView in your ListView, which I speculate it was there in 3.4 (I never used it) and it was removed in 3.6. This doesn’t equally replace the TreeView, but is a nice addition anyway.
Cosimo also made a big clean up and he removed NautilusDesktopBackground with the message “It’s gone! \o/” :)
Tree in List View
In Display Options Panel of Files there is now a <Navigate Folders in a Tree> Preference.
Cosimo also managed to remove all the dependencies to <nautilus-desktop-background.c> (which was including a set of functions to manipulate desktop aspects) and he deleted the file with the funny message: It’s gone! \o/
Changelogs
Major changes include
3.7.90
- Add back a Treeview option for list view. This is off by default, and is backed by a checkbox in the Preferences dialog
- Add a “Connect to Server” item in the Network section of the sidebar
- Add a “Format…” item in volume context menus in the sidebar
- Fix accelerators not showing up in gear and view menus
- Use G_APP_INFO_CREATE_NEEDS_TERMINAL instead of handrolled code (William Jon McCann)
3.7.5
- Switch to hovered locations on DnD (William Jon McCann)
- Support a –force-desktop commandline option for classic mode
- Add a separate desktop file for classic mode integration
- Use a better position for navigation button popup menus
- Fix many memory leaks (Pavel Vasin)
- Fix a crasher when a file in trash has reserved characters in the filename
- Fix a crasher when closing the sidebar immediately after construction
- Fix a crasher closing the properties dialog while calculating folder size
- Fix backup files showing up in search provider results
- Fix floating bar buttons being added twice
3.7.3
- Update search provider to org.gnome.Shell.SearchProvider2 interface
- Rely on GIO to parse “.hidden” files
- Consistently use unicode ellipsis instead of three periods (Jeremy Bicha)
- Use a different label for removing a file from “Recent” (Paolo Borelli)
- Restore the previous behavior wrt. framing for custom icons
- Share the “show hidden” GSetting option with the GTK+ file chooser (Timothy Arceri)
- Fix missing unmount sync notification under some circumstances
- Fix infinite loop while deep counting the size of “/” (Phillip Susi)
- Fix wrong filename when restoring file from trash (Timothy Arceri)
3.7.2
- Request to render larger thumbnails by default
- Don’t quote the current location name in search bar
- Use “Run” in menus when launchine executables
- Fix stray Empty Document item in New Document menu
3.7.1
- Turn on again recursive search for the simple engine
- Enable incremental loading for search directories
- Add extra information to image properties page
- Show free space pie chart for the local root filesystem
- Resolve symbolic links before launching a file
- Avoid sync I/O when reading bookmark locations
- Don’t add non-existent XDG folders to the sidebar
- Don’t offer to remove built-in XDG folder bookmarks
- Fix black input field when renaming a file in icon view with XIM enabled
- Fix wrong return location when unmounting a remote mount
- Fix notebook tabs not properly switching after timeout when hovered
- Fix search toggle button state inconsistent when switching between tabs
- Fix crasher when using the Tracker engine from the Shell search provider
- Fix crasher in Shell search provider
- Fix crasher when unmounting a volume under certain circumstances

